How to update the existing knowledge base created with a knowledge graph?

You can update the existing knowledge base created with the knowledge graph as an RAG definition by adding a chunk to it.

  • Select the existing knowledge base created using a knowledge graph.

  • Click on the knowledge base file name.

  • Click ‘+Add Chunk' and provide the chunk details in the box, and click on 'Save’.

  • You can also update the existing chunk. Click the ‘pencil' icon at the rightmost corner and edit the chunk, and click 'Save’.

  • Once you edit or add a chunk, you can track the status in the dashboard.

  • The chunk is saved immediately and becomes part of the existing knowledge base.

  • You can find the updated knowledge graph, which now includes the new entity.

Updating metadata

  • Select the appropriate option from the ‘Document Type’ dropdown, edit the metadata, and click ‘Save’ on the right-side panel titled ‘Document Metadata’

  • Once you save the updated metadata, it will be applied to all chunks. Click on any chunk to view the updated metadata.
